This paper models focus value curve from point light source to focus measure calculation.
This model shows that focus values of one object in a scene will form a single
peak bell-shaped curve in camera. Our proposed auto focus method adopts this model
with focus sub-window selection to predict the peak of focus value curve. Accurate prediction
for the best-focused lens position will greatly shorten search time. Besides, the
period of focus value feedback from camera chip is further considered to determine lens
step in one period to optimize practical time consumption. Through experiments, our
model for focus value curve is correct and proposed auto focus method efficiently shortens
overall search time.
